Aglow with promise: 35 Castletown Boulevard, Weir Views, 3338

In a newer enclave on the edge of town, midway between Melton South and Exford primary schools, this sparkling modern residence, perched amid pretty gardens, holds much attraction for families wanting to move in and relax.

The decor captures today’s look, with pearl-grey wall paint and splashes of soft-aubergine on accent walls, and carpets, all tiling and roller blinds in shades of grey – all creating a harmonious flow.

 

35 Castletown Boulevard, Weir Views, 3338

 

Entry under a porch is to a tiled hallway which veers gently to the right, thus cleverly concealing the emergence of the living hub from strangers at the door.

A carpeted open lounge room is the first space off the entry hall, while the main bedroom is opposite. This has oaken-grey floor planks and one of those accent walls, as well as walk-through robes and an
en suite decked out in extensive tiling with mosaic feature strips, a large shower and a dual-basin vanity.

The two remaining fitted and carpeted bedrooms are along a rear hallway which they share with the main bathroom, separate toilet and laundry with workbench and storage.

The spacious living hub has an island wall that beautifully defines zones. One of these is a stylish sitting area, laid with oaken-grey floorboards (other floors are tiled) and with another accent wall and a contemporary gas log fire set in stacked stone.

The smart kitchen has loads of white cupboards, a walk-in pantry, splashback tiles with mosaic strip, charcoal benches, an island brekkie bar for four and a gas cooktop, wall oven and integrated microwave.

A spacious undercover alfresco area with tropical plantings against a wide-format bamboo screen is an appealing area in which to relax and entertain.

Gardens are an obvious labour of love, with islands of dense plantings, a wooden bridge across river stones and a lovely contemplation area with raised deck and wooden seating amid leafiness.

Other noteworthy features include a split-system, ceiling fans, downlights, steel-mesh security doors, video intercom, a large garden shed hidden behind foliage, and a drive-through double garage.
